Question
marine10980
I was originally 80% service connected for a litany of issues but 70% for ptsd. I was going to the psych and was given medication which i had bad side effects from. After telling the dr over and over again I finally stopped showing up. I would get notices from the va and simply throw them away without looking at them. Well in 2009 I was reduced from 80% total to 70% total. Fast forward to 2014 and the va was actually shorting me on the 70% money and in speaking to the VSO they said I should ask for an increase because my symptoms at the time had been worsening. I filed a claim for an increase in feb and my claim was approved for 100% ptsd. however the effective date was july 1. and my c&p exam was in june. Why would it not be an effective date from feb when I filed for an increase? Please advise.
